About the author

Mary Kubica is a New York Times and USA Today bestselling author known for her emotionally charged, twist-filled suspense novels. A former high school history teacher, she holds a B.A. in History and American Literature from Miami University in Oxford, Ohio. Her books have been translated into over thirty languages and have sold millions of copies worldwide, earning her praise as “a helluva storyteller.” She lives outside Chicago with her husband and children.

About the book

It's Not Her is a gripping thriller about two families who find themselves at the heart of a chilling crime and a mysterious disappearance whiole vacationing at a secluded lake resort. Courtney Gray’s peaceful getaway shatters when a scream pierces the night. Rushing to the neighboring cottage, she finds her brother and sister-in-law dead, her teenage niece Reese missing, and her young nephew Wyatt sleeping peacefully upstairs.

As police descend on the quiet resort town, long-buried secrets about Courtney’s family, and the town itself, begin to surface. Courtney is left to wonder whether Reese is another victim, or the prime suspect. With each revelation, she uncovers more lies and betrayals, realizing that everyone has something to hide, with danger growing as she inches closer to the truth.
